Nice work, how far apart are your A-arm pivot points? Mine are right around 17mm as planned now.The overall width of my ZZ chassis will be much larger than stock but it will look like a RC buggy/stadium truck so it should be OK.
Working at this scale is a challenge.I find myself trying to come up with ways to make things work that are somewhat easy to make.
Like the a-arms will most likely pivot on a piece of piano wire from the hobby shop(small,strong,springy).The top a-arm will most likely have to be made out of piano wire also since it will also double as the spring.
I'm still trying to stuff 2 motors in there somewhere and it will have to use a li-poly battery.
I have found some very small bearings so most of it will run on bearings.
Since I plan on using a slot car crown gear I can change the orientation of the motor to vertical,horizontal front or rear of axle and still be inside the chassis.
I need to somehow convert the ZZ-se servo into a more useful compact servo.(Havnt even touched on that yet)
The drawings are still very rough and I dont think I have much more than an hour total into drawing them, they are just some idea's right now but I have thought a lot about it.
The fun will come when I feel I actually have something worth cutting/making.It would be better if I had someone local to me to help on this and to test run these once they are in the testing stage.

I'm interested in your rear suspension plans. That is probably the hardest part of making an off-road chasis out of these little cars. I leaned towards the stadium truck model because of their straight axle, but ANY rear suspension, never mind independent, is tough.
oh, and the front a-arms, fully spread, extend the stance to 4 centimeteres. The pivot points are 8mm apart, and the arms themselves are 9mm.

I could just take the easy way out and use the ZZ-mt front dogbones/axles for the rear axle but I think I'll just go with the simple dogbone setup.
I'm thinking the rear axle with crown gear pressed on then a round slotted aluminum piece pressed on each side of it that has been drilled out to receive the dogbone.The bearings would support the aluminum pieces, it could be very compact and simple.
